Job Outlook for Pharmacy Technicians.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), demand for pharmacy technicians will grow 12% through 2028 – that equates to over 30,000 new jobs! The BLS notes that on average, pharmacy technicians earn an annual salary of $32,700. Top earners can make up to $47,000 per year. Pharmacy Technicians FAQs.

Benefits of earning an IV certification for pharmacy technicians. Here are some benefits of earning an IV certification as a pharmacy technician: The certification doesn't take long to earn. Many courses for IV certification take only a few days, and the longest may take a few weeks to complete. upholstery tacks lowes Associate degree programs offer classes in pharmacy calculations, pharmacology, hospital pharmacy, and pharmaceutical dosage. Some associate degree programs also require practicum experiences so that students can gain hands-on experience.
